WebEndoFLIP can help find the cause of difficulty swallowing; for example, in patients with suspected achalasia, or in patients who have difficulty swallowing after surgery for g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D). EndoFLIP can also be used to perform a therapeutic dilation, without the need for X-rays. WebEGD is done in a hospital or medical center. The procedure uses an endoscope. This is a flexible tube with a light and camera at the end. During the procedure, your breathing, heart rate, blood pressure, and oxygen level are checked. Wires are attached to certain areas of your body and then to machines that monitor these vital signs. WebApr 11, 2024 · Performing an esophagogastroduodenoscopy (EGD) at this point would worsen the patient’s general condition because of the severe upper abdominal pain, the presence of HPVG, and the large amount of gastric residue on the CT. The patient was diagnosed with HPVG due to acute gastric dilation (AGD) and hospitalized without EGD.
